Bregolin wrote: > Hello, > > > bird (all versions) does not send BGP route withdrawals when a protocol is > removed, only when the filter changes or the protocol is disabled. Is this > intentional? If not, could it be a configurable option to send route > withdrawals upon protocols being removed?
Hello Do you mean route withdrawals for routes received from that removed protocol? Send to other peers? This should not be an issue - when a protocol is removed or disabled, all its routes are removed and withdrawals should be sent to other protocols. > I am having an issue where the peers keep stale routes that were removed > from bird but were not withdrawn via update messages.
